WebSmart devices – AI and IoT form Smart Machines. The combination of IoT solutions with AI enables real-time reactions, for example via a remote video camera that reads license plates or analyzes faces. In addition, AI processes data afterwards, such as searching for patterns in data and performing predictive analyzes. WebHere, 4 fundamental components of IoT system, which tells us how IoT works. i. Sensors/Devices First, sensors or devices help in collecting very minute data from the surrounding environment. All of this collected data can have various degrees of complexities ranging from a simple temperature monitoring sensor or a complex full video feed.

As below are procedures of IoT device management: Step 1:Provisioning. Provisioning is the first step in IoT device management, where a smart device needs to be connected to the Internet in order to work properly. This step is to create an account for the first time, and set up a network …
